I have purchased a couple of 10 bar VDO pressure senders for my DL1 and know they have to be calibrated.
My questions are, do they need a pull up resistor, and if so what ratings, and does anyone have the calibration data in PSI
Many thanks
VDO senders
I'm running a VDO 10bar sender for the oil pressure, came up with the following cal with the standard pull-up resistor (think it's 1kOhm, whatever's shown in the instructions on the website):
3.81 * x^3 + 2.95 * x^2 + 9.09 * x - 0.38
That should pretty much drop in copy/paste into the variable editor (was generated from measurements/table of values)...
HTH...
Oh, I should add, that's for values in bar...
